Why you should take a tour of Auschwitz and Birkenau

Visiting Auschwitz and Birkenau is an important opportunity to learn about the history of the Holocaust and commemorate the victims. However, there are several reasons why you should choose a guided tour rather than going on your own. Below, we will explain the reasons in detail. 1. In-depth historical commentary by a professional guide Auschwitz and Birkenau are the sites of tragedies caused by the Nazis. If you visit on your own, it is difficult to deeply understand the background and historical context just by looking at the exhibits and facilities. On official tours and reliable tours, a professional guide will explain in detail the structure of the camps, the harsh life of the prisoners, Nazi policies, etc. For example, you can hear specific episodes inside the gas chambers and barracks, which will further deepen your understanding of history. It is not just a tourist spot, but a meaningful experience as a place to learn about the past. 2. Free admission for individuals is limited after 4 p.m. If you visit on your own, admission is free after 4 p.m. However, the viewing time is short during this time, it is difficult to take your time, and it is cold and dark in winter. Also, visiting Birkenau outdoors on rainy or cold days is particularly difficult. With a tour, you can visit during the morning or daytime, which is a good time, and the weather can be minimized. Difficulty in booking official tours and waiting times The official tours of the Auschwitz-Birkenau Museum are popular due to their high level of expertise, but the reality is that they are very difficult to book. During peak periods, they can be fully booked several weeks in advance. In addition, official tours can require long waits at the gate, and waiting in the rain or cold can be physically exhausting. Smooth travel and efficient tours Auschwitz I (the main camp) and Birkenau (Auschwitz II) are located far apart, and it takes time for an individual to efficiently visit both. If you use public transportation, you will have to take the time to check timetables and transfers. With a tour, you will have a round-trip bus from Krakow and a well-balanced schedule to visit both facilities.
